Why You Need an asbestos settlement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Asbestos victims should seek legal assistance through national firms that specialize in asbestos cases.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will offer a no-cost case evaluation to determine whether you qualify for compensation. In addition, the top m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ingent basis. This arrangement maximizes compensation for clients.

1. Experience

If you or someone you know has mesothelioma or asbestosis or any other asbestos law-related disease, it is important to hire a lawyer with experience to help you get compensation. Asbestos victims can seek damages to cover their financial losses from companies that exposed them to asbestos's toxic.

Asbestos victims are given a limited amount of time to file a claim or they may be barred from taking legal action. A New York asbestos lawyer can help you to file your claim within legal deadlines and ensure that all relevant laws are followed.

Mesothelioma lawyers are familiar with the complex rules and regulations that surround asbestos litigation. They also have the knowledge necessary to gather evidence and construct a compelling case before juries and judges. A top-rated lawyer will have a track record of helping clients receive the full and fair compensation they deserve for their losses.

A number of the top mesothelioma law firms have offices in New York, including Weitz & Luxenberg, Cooney & Conway, and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team of attorneys and paralegals who can assist you to file an asbestos lawsuit in the state where it is most likely to succeed.

Asbestos litigation is a worldwide practice, and most large mesothelioma law companies have national reach. It is essential to locate an asbestos lawyer who has local presence and is able to meet with you personally, if at all feasible. Local offices can make you feel more comfortable when discussing your case. They can also help you with the process because they eliminate some of the stress associated from traveling.

If you're interviewing candidates, ask them about their experience in asbestos litigation. Find out what the firm's approach is for each case and how it plans to fight on your behalf. Find out who will manage your case. Non-lawyer case manager are usually employed by large companies. Also, find out how quickly they respond to phone calls and emails.

A mesothelioma verdict or settlement may cover medical expenses, lost wages, home care costs funeral and burial costs, as well as other expenses. Many victims receive millions of dollars in compensation.
